The Significance of Relief Society: A Tapestry of Faith, Service, and Empowerment
The Relief Society, a vital organization within The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, has touched the lives of countless women since its inception in 1842. Through acts of service, faith-building initiatives, and leadership opportunities, the Relief Society empowers women to fulfill their divine roles and make a profound impact on their families, communities, and the world.
A History Steeped in Divine Mandate
<center><img src="https://tse1.mm.bing.net/th?q=Relief Society History" alt="Relief Society History"></center>
The Relief Society was established in Nauvoo, Illinois, under the direction of the Prophet Joseph Smith. He declared, "This organization is designed to relieve the poor, to save souls, and to look after the needy." With its humble beginnings, the Relief Society has grown into a global organization, reaching over 7.1 million women in 190 countries.

Quotes that Illumine the Path
<center><img src="https://tse1.mm.bing.net/th?q=Relief Society Quotes" alt="Relief Society Quotes"></center>
"The Relief Society is the Lord's organization to bless the lives of women and all those they love." - Linda K. Burton, former Relief Society General President
"Through the Relief Society, the women of the Church are uniting their hearts, hands, and prayers in fulfilling the purposes of the Lord." - Russell M. Nelson, President of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ints
